CareTrust REIT (CTRE) presents a dichotomy between strong balance sheet health and fundamental overvaluation. While the Piotroski F-Score of 4/9 indicates stable financial health and the Debt/Equity ratio (0.72) is significantly superior to the sector average (2.76), the stock trades at a substantial premium to its Graham Number ($25.3) and Intrinsic Value ($22.77). Recent performance is marred by a streak of four consecutive earnings misses with an average surprise of -11.89%, offsetting the bullish analyst consensus. The outlook remains neutral as the market price reflects growth expectations that are not currently supported by recent earnings delivery.
Lineage, Inc. exhibits significant fundamental weakness, highlighted by a critical Piotroski F-Score of 2/9, indicating poor financial health. While the stock trades at a slight discount to book value (P/B 0.94) and has recently outperformed low earnings expectations, these are overshadowed by a 0/100 technical trend and stagnant revenue growth (-0.20% YoY). Liquidity is a concern with a current ratio of 0.80, and the negative forward P/E suggests continued profitability struggles. The high dividend yield of 6.20% appears unsustainable given the negative profit margins.
